059 TheBanishment


 In the name of Allah, the Beneficent the Merciful.


 1. Whatever is in the heavens and whatever is in the earth 
 declares the glory of Allah, and He is the Mighty, the Wise.

 2. He it is Who caused those who disbelieved of the 
 followers of the Book to go forth from their homes at the 
 first banishment you did not think that they would go forth, 
 while they were certain that their fortresses would defend 
 them against Allah; but Allah came to them whence they did 
 not expect, and cast terror into their hearts; they 
 demolished their houses with their own hands and the hands 
 of the believers; therefore take a lesson, O you who have 
 eyes!

 3. And had it not been that Allah had decreed for them the 
 exile, He would certainly have punished them in this world, 
 and m the hereafter they shall have chastisement of the 
 fire.

 4. That is because they acted in opposition to Allah and His 
 Apostle, and whoever acts in opposition to Allah, then 
 surely Allah is severe in retributing (evil).

 5. Whatever palm-tree you cut down or leave standing upon 
 its roots, It 15 by Allah's command, and that He may abase 
 the transgressors.

 6. And whatever Allah restored to His Apostle from them you 
 did not press forward against it any horse or a riding camel 
 but Allah gives authority to His apostles against whom He 
 pleases, and Allah has power over all things.

 7. Whatever Allah has restored to His Apostle from the 
 people of the towns, it is for Allah and for the Apostle, 
 and for the near of kin and the orphans and the needy and 
 the wayfarer, so that it may not be a thing taken by turns 
 among the rich of you, and whatever the Apostle gives you, 
 accept it, and from whatever he forbids you, keep back, and 
 be careful of (your duty to) Allah; surely Allah is severe 
 in retributing (evil):

 8. (It is) for the poor who fled their homes and their 
 possessions, seeking grace of Allah and (His) pleasure, and 
 assisting Allah and His Apostle: these it is that are the 
 truthful.

 9. And those who made their abode in the city and in the 
 faith before them love those who have fled to them, and do 
 not find in their hearts a need of what they are given, and 
 prefer (them) before themselves though poverty may afflict 
 them, and whoever is preserved from the niggardliness of his 
 soul, these it is that are the successful ones.

 10. And those who come after them say: Our Lord! forgive us 
 and those of our brethren who had precedence of us in faith, 
 and do not allow any spite to remain in our hearts towards 
 those who believe, our Lord! surely Thou art Kind, Merciful.

 11. Have you not seen those who have become hypocrites? They 
 say to those of their brethren who disbelieve from among the 
 followers of the Book: If you are driven forth, we shall 
 certainly go forth with you, and we will never obey any one 
 concerning you, and if you are fought against, we will 
 certainly help you, and Allah bears witness that they are 
 most surely liars.

 12. Certainly if these are driven forth, they will not go 
 forth with them, and if they are fought against, they will 
 not help them, and even if they help-them, they will 
 certainly turn (their) backs, then they shall not be helped.

 13. You are certainly greater in being feared in their 
 hearts than Allah; that is because they are a people who do 
 not understand

 14. They will not fight against you in a body save in 
 fortified towns or from behind walls; their fighting between 
 them is severe, you may think them as one body, and their 
 hearts are disunited; that is because they are a people who 
 have no sense.

 15. Like those before them shortly; they tasted the evil 
 result of their affair, and they shall have a painful 
 punishment.

 16. Like the Shaitan when he says to man: Disbelieve, but 
 when he disbelieves, he says: I am surely clear of you; 
 surely I fear Allah, the Lord of the worlds.

 17. Therefore the end of both of them is that they are both 
 in the fire to abide therein, and that is the reward of the 
 unjust.

 18. O you who believe! be careful of (your duty to) Allah, 
 and let every soul consider what it has sent on for the 
 morrow, and be careful of (your duty to) Allah; surely Allah 
 is Aware of what you do.

 19. And be not like those who forsook Allah, so He made them 
 forsake their own souls: these it is that are the 
 transgressors.

 20. Not alike are the inmates of the fire and the dwellers 
 of the garden: the dwellers of the garden are they that are 
 the achievers.

 21. Had We sent down this Quran on a mountain, you would 
 certainly have seen it falling down, splitting asunder 
 because of the fear of Allah, and We set forth these 
 parables to men that they may reflect.

 22. He is Allah besides Whom there is no god; the Knower of 
 the unseen and the seen; He is the Beneficent, the Merciful

 23. He is Allah, besides Whom there is no god; the King, the 
 Holy, the Giver of peace, the Granter of security, Guardian 
 over all, the Mighty, the Supreme, the Possessor of every 
 greatness Glory be to Allah from what they set up (with 
 Him).

 24. He is Allah the Creator, the Maker, the Fashioner; His 
 are the most excellent names; whatever is in the heavens and 
 the earth declares His glory; and He is the Mighty, the 
 Wise.
